Appart Hotel Nuiteejour Le Mans Centre Jaures
47.98699, 0.2083Located within a 10-minute drive of University of Maine, Appart Hotel Nuiteejour Le Mans Centre Jaures features parking for those who travel by car. The apartment provides quick access to Sarthe Development, which is a mere 7 minutes' walk away.
Location
Gallo-Roman walls of Le Mans can be reached in 25 minutes by foot.
Aeroport Le Mans-Arnage airport is located 10 km away, while Saint-Martin bus station is in proximity to this apartment.
Rooms
Guests will take advantage of sound-proofed windows, as well as a flat-screen TV with satellite channels, and such comforts as an iron and ironing board. The accommodation is also furnished with a writing table. Beds fitted with non-allergenic pillows are at guests' disposal. A separate toilet and a shower are provided upon request. Moreover, there are a dryer, toiletries, and bath sheets as well.
Eat & Drink
Along with a minibar, the apartment is equipped with a kitchen that includes a refrigerator, an oven, and kitchenware.
Leisure & Business
Thanks to horseback riding, bowling, and cycling in the area, guests can stay fit.
